Post-Production Finishing Artist (Color & Sound)
  • Premium TV Pilot Share via: facebook x linkedin email El Segundo , California Hybrid Position Post Production
  • Editing, Compositing, Motion Graphics, & Visual Effects Contracted Orca Brands Apply The Project American Castle is a 30-minute television pilot that demands a cinematic, top-tier broadcast finish.
The heavy lifting is done; the rough cut is locked. Now, we need an elite finishing artist to execute a flawless final polish. If you are a master of your craft who thrives on the challenge of bringing a distinct, high-end visual and auditory project to life, we want you. The Scope of Work We are looking for a comprehensive, TV-worthy finish across two critical pillars:
  • Elite Color Grading:
    Establish a rich, cinematic, consistent visual identity. You will handle full color correction, matching disparate footage, and applying a premium, high-end grade that screams network television.
  • Masterful Sound Design & Mix:
    Full audio overhaul. This includes seamless dialogue editing, comprehensive noise reduction, sound effects (SFX) design, and a professional stereo/surround mix balanced perfectly for broadcast and streaming standards.
  • The Final Polish:
    Delivering a flawless, technically perfect 30-minute master. Who You Are
  • A Proven Professional:
    You have a portfolio of broadcast television, feature films, or high-end streaming content.
  • Technically Meticulous:
    You know industry delivery specs inside and out.
  • A Decisive Collaborator:
    You don't need hand-holding. You can take a strong creative vision, run with it, and deliver perfection on a tight deadline.
